To get a package into the debian archive, there are 2 ways:
have a sponsored upload or become a debian developer.
To become a debian developer, you join the new-maintainers queue and
fullfill those tasks which take about 1 year. The other option is to
seek a debian developer to sponsor your package. This means that they
examine it for policy compliance, bugs, code quality, etc. and if they
think its ok for Debian, they will upload it into the debian archive for
inclusion in 'unstable' where it will join the other 16,000 packages on
it happy little journey to 'stable'. The debian-mentors.net {website|irc
channel|mailing list} is the best way to get help as well as the info on
the debian-womens site.
Also, try to use linda and lintian to check your package.
